Hanaan Shahin, mom of Wadea Al-Fayoume, boy killed in alleged unincorp. Plainfield hate crime, to speak out Wednesday

PLAINFIELD, Ill. (WLS) — The mother of a Plainfield boy killed in an apparent act of hate is expected to share her story at a press conference Wednesday morning.

Hanan Shahin, 32, is set to publicly speak for the first time after her six-year-old son, Wadea Al-Fayoume, was stabbed to death, allegedly by their landlord in Plainfield on October 14.

Shahin has retained nationally renowned civil right attorney Ben Crump.

According to the Chicago Chapter of the Council on American-Islamic Relations, Shahin says Al-Fayoume was “her best friend.” She is “praying for peace”…and “harbors no hatred…but believes in the pursuit of justice.”

The Will County Sheriff’s Office said 71-year-old Joseph Czuba allegedly stabbed Al-Fayoume 26 times and his mother more than a dozen because they were Muslim.

Czuba faces first degree murder charges, hate crime charges and others.

The Department of Justice has also opened a federal investigation into Al-Fayoume’s death.
